Roles and Responsibilities:

  • Interpret, allocate, tailor, write and flow down requirements to all levels of a system architecture

  • Design and develop mission planning architectures, perform hardware/software integration and testing, certification and requirements analysis

  • Trade studies, documenting architectures, analyzing performance, and evaluating Technology Readiness Level (TRL) with regard to supplier current and future products offerings

  • Document designs using detailed schematics, diagrams and specifications

  • Collaborate with engineers and program stakeholders to integrate mission planning solutions to meet platform mission objectives

  • Technical management of program strategic partners and suppliers, including development, acquisition, acceptance, qualification, system integration and test support

  • Developing supplier documentation, performance based specifications, and statements of work

  • Building supplier evaluation criteria and experience in conducting technical evaluations, documenting results and selection

  • Review documents from the supplier’s development effort and support supplier technical interchange meetings and design reviews

A successful Mission Planning Responsible Engineer has good leadership skills and understands the scope of the work and the impact of the work on other teams, consistently brings up concerns, issues and risks to program and technical leadership and holds the team to a high level of technical rigor.
